The most significant obstacle in cooking shrimp is analyzing if they’re finished. Undercook they usually’ll be mushy and translucent; overcook plus they’ll be rubbery and just about inedible. The easiest way to convey to when shrimp are cooked as a result of is to search for visual cues: “Look ahead to the shrimp to curl and turn opaque,” says Kendra.

 Like in all decapods, the white shrimp’s shell truly is usually a skeleton on the skin of its entire body. The exoskeleton does not grow, and thus the prawn ought to molt (get rid of) it routinely so that you can expand more substantial. Just before molting, somebody begins creating a new, larger skeleton inside of the existing 1. As it gets much too large to get contained, it splits open up the outer shell, and the new exoskeleton hardens. In the course of this method, The brand new exoskeleton is often tender for quite a few several hours, as well as prawn is very vulnerable to predation.
